Output 666ae2838384fe225298f16d9198b4392f7cc42150a80f7a96a07841641e77c2:1
- value
- 1528907245
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f549ab0b0e747612893dc552aeb69c6f95609b4c OP_EQUAL
- address
- 3Q3yj6QuqRJ7NpexBkgrnjnvHFNhxcJ8Bk
- transaction
- 666ae2838384fe225298f16d9198b4392f7cc42150a80f7a96a07841641e77c2